The UAP documents reveal that the Aliens Among Us slot RTP is 96.36% and comes with a medium-to-high volatility setting. Players will therefore experience gaming that can produce bouts of low-level wins, with the occasional larger payout. But overall, the hit rate will be lower than moderate.
The game uses a classic Hacksaw Gaming layout of six reels and five rows, with 19 paylines. To win, a payline must host three or more matching symbols. This can lead to a maximum win of 15,000x your stake. The price of bets starts at $0.10 and rises to $50. This makes the maximum possible jackpot of $750,000!
Having previously examined older Hacksaw Gaming slots, we found that features and bonuses followed a pattern. With Aliens Among Us, it continues. During your experience of this alien game, you might land one of three free spin bonus games. There are also the four expanding reels and the ever-present Buy Bonus feature.

Yes. The main bonus game is a free spins bonus, but Hacksaw Gaming doesn’t just give you one; they give you two. The Beam Me Up bonus, which is unlocked with three FS symbols, and the Farmageddon bonus, which is unlocked with four FS symbols. Both bonuses come with ten free spins.
Hacksaw Gaming online slots come with Buy Bonus features. These side bets offer players the chance to buy in-game features or to spend their money on buying entry into the bonus rounds. Beam Me Up bonus costs 100x the bet, while Farmageddon costs 200x the bet amount.
